Transaction 203c73f98d710618873cac2af1f27a2a0988004147a7516881128f13a644f787

2 Input
2 Outputs
  • 203c73f98d710618873cac2af1f27a2a0988004147a7516881128f13a644f787:0
  • value  426391437
    address  38Cqu6SH9TirCghUpxzTRx73wjMwamiiQY
  • 203c73f98d710618873cac2af1f27a2a0988004147a7516881128f13a644f787:1
  • value  2000000000
    address  18nujGgYwHSLwuyT8nfZDWdmRKYcpuSKkv